Ingredients for Spicy Chicken Teriyaki Recipe
- 2 lbs boneless, skinless chicken breasts, cut into 1-inch pieces
- 1/2 cup soy sauce
- 1/4 cup honey
- 2 tablespoons rice vinegar
- 2 tablespoons sesame oil
- 1 tablespoon grated fresh ginger
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 tablespoon cornstarch
- 1 teaspoon red pepper flakes (adjust to your spice preference)
- 1 tablespoon sesame seeds
- 1/2 cup sliced green onions
- Cooked rice or noodles for serving
The meticulous selection of ingredients is crucial. High-quality soy sauce and honey contribute significantly to the overall flavor profile. The ginger and garlic provide aromatic depth. Don’t hesitate to adjust the amount of red pepper flakes to suit your preferred spice level.

Step-by-Step Preparation of Spicy Chicken Teriyaki Recipe
- In a large bowl, combine the soy sauce, honey, rice vinegar, sesame oil, ginger, garlic, cornstarch, and red pepper flakes. Whisk until the cornstarch is fully dissolved.
- Add the chicken pieces to the marinade and toss gently to coat evenly. Cover the bowl and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es (or up to 2 hours) to allow the chicken to marinate thoroughly.
- Heat a tablespoon of sesame oil in a large skillet or wok over medium-high heat.
- Carefully place the marinated chicken pieces in the hot skillet and cook until golden brown and cooked through, about 5-7 minutes per side. Ensure the chicken is cooked to an internal temperature of 165°F (74°C).
- Remove the chicken from the skillet and set aside.
- Pour the marinade into the skillet and bring to a simmer, scraping up any browned bits from the bottom of the pan. Cook for 2-3 minutes, or until the sauce thickens slightly.
- Return the cooked chicken to the skillet and toss to coat with the sauce. Serve immediately over cooked rice or noodles, garnished with sliced green onions and sesame seeds.

Variations and Serving Suggestions for Spicy Chicken Teriyaki Recipe
This recipe is exceptionally versatile. You can substitute chicken thighs for breasts for a richer flavor. Add a splash of sriracha for extra heat. For a vegetarian option, replace the chicken with firm tofu, marinating it in the same sauce and cooking until golden brown and heated through. Serve over brown rice or quinoa for a complete meal.

FAQ
Here are some frequently asked questions about this Spicy Chicken Teriyaki Recipe.
- Q: Can I use pre-made teriyaki sauce?
A: Yes, you can substitute pre-made teriyaki sauce for the homemade marinade, but the taste will differ slightly. - Q: How long can I store leftovers?
A: Store leftover Spicy Chicken Teriyaki in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. - Q: Can I make this recipe ahead of time?
A: Yes, you can marinate the chicken ahead of time. However, it’s best to cook the chicken just before serving to ensure the optimal flavor and texture.
